Heroes: Name a crappy town after yourself

crappytown_thumb7The Austin Browncoats have teamed with QMx to auction off the right to name some cities of the 'verse in the upcoming QMx Serenity Atlas:

Quantum Mechanix (QMx) is sponsoring the "Name the Crappy Town Where You’re a Hero" charity auction. Starting on April 20th, 50 town names will be auctioned via eBay with all proceeds supporting Equality Now. If you win an auction, your name will be submitted, and pending studio approval, will be used in the upcoming official Atlas of the 'Verse, Volume One: The Trader's Guild Guide to the New Canaan Run made by our favorite mild-manner graphic designer, Ben Mund.
